Best Neighbourhoods in Birmingham

Birmingham boasts diverse neighborhoods, each offering distinct local experiences.

Jewellery Quarter
• Home to over 100 jewelry shops
• Rich in Victorian architecture
Birmingham City Centre
• Hub for shopping, dining, and entertainment
• Features iconic attractions like the Bullring
Kings Heath
• Vibrant community with eclectic shops
• Known for its lively music scene

Best Times To Visit Birmingham's Attractions

Strategizing your visit can greatly enhance your experience in Birmingham.

Birmingham Museum and Art Gallery
Weekdays in the morning offer a quieter atmosphere and more personal exploration.
Cadbury World
Visit midweek or during school hours to sidestep bustling crowds.
Gas Street Basin
Early mornings or late afternoons provide a serene backdrop for walks.

Birmingham Weather: What to Expect Year-Round

Birmingham experiences a temperate maritime climate, characterized by mild winters and cool summers, making it a year-round destination. Spring and early autumn often provide the best weather for outdoor activities, so consider these seasons for a more enjoyable experience.

Dining Recommendation

For a taste of Birmingham's vibrant culinary scene, try the iconic Balti curry at one of the celebrated restaurants in the city’s famous Balti Triangle, offering a bold blend of spices that stands in contrast to the more traditional Scottish fare in Dunfermline. The lively atmosphere and communal dining style here provide a unique experience, showcasing local ingredients and a diverse flavor profile that you won’t find back home.

Useful tips for bus travellers
• Arrive at Dunfermline bus station at least 30 minutes prior to your departure to allow time for any last-minute changes and to ensure you board your FlixBus on time; you can check the live schedules at FlixBus Schedule.
• During the approximate 9-hour journey, pack snacks and comfort items, as there may not be regular meal stops; it's a good idea to bring a portable phone charger for entertainment and to keep your devices powered during the trip.
• Upon arriving at Birmingham Summer Row- Great Charles Street station, take advantage of the nearby amenities such as the Bullring shopping centre just a short walk away, and familiarize yourself with local transport options like the Birmingham tram system, which you can explore further at Birmingham Transportation.
